His bed is NOT NEARLY as comfortable as mine. His bed is .................than mine.
1) a lot / far / much more uncomfortable 2) a lot / far / much less comfortable
She is a lot better than all the other singers. I think she's .................singer I've ever listened to.
by far the best
My friend runs more quickly than me. I don't run .................my friend does.
as quickly as
Skiing is not as dangerous as kite surfing. Skiing is _____________ than kite surfing
safer / less dangerous
My daddy is very tall so he finds it easy to reach high places. The ............a person is, the .........it is to reach high places.
1) taller / 2)easier
The brown shoes cost the same as the black shoes, that means that the brown shoes are ..................the black shoes
as expensive as
He prefers playing soccer to playing rugby. He likes playing soccer _____________ playing rugby.
more than
I prefer this cafe. The other one is 1)____________ ( not / comfortable) this one, and the waiters are 2)_________ (friendly) too.
1) not as comfortable as /  2) friendlier / more friendly
My car is a lot newer than yours. Your car is much ................ mine. You need to buy a new one!!!
older than
The website is the __________ (useful) of all the ones I´ve looked at. It gives no real information at all.
least useful
Today's class was far more difficult than yesterday's. Yesterday's class wasn't ......................as today's class.
nearly as difficult as
This is 1)............... the worst meal in my life. I've never had a 2).................meal than this one.Yuk!!!
1) by far / easily       2) worse
I laughed a lot! It was the ...........................film I've ever seen.
by far the most hilarious / by far the funniest
The noise in the city is unbearable.I enjoy living in the country. It's a ..............................than the city
lot more peaceful
I felt very ill last week. Although I am still in bed, I feel a ................................
bit / little better
Bariloche is .............................than Rosario. The journey to Bariloche lasts 12 hours.
much / far / a lot farther / further
